1. The Rise of Server Virtualisation

Server virtualisation is redefining how businesses use data centres. Traditionally, one server served one function, inefficient and costly. Now, managed service providers (MSPs) leverage virtualisation to recreate compute and storage capabilities as software, distributing workloads across multiple virtual machines on fewer physical servers.

2. Hybrid Cloud: Flexibility Meets Control

In the era of data sovereignty and growing privacy concerns, hybrid cloud architecture stands out. Companies can protect their sensitive operations within private cloud environments, while simultaneously leveraging public clouds for enhanced flexibility and scalable resources that adapt to demand. This blend avoids vendor lock-in, enables resource optimisation, and supports diverse computing needs.

3. Hyperscale Data Centres: Meeting Massive Demand

With explosive data growth, hyperscale data centres are becoming essential. These infrastructures are designed to host thousands of servers and enable rapid scalability, performance, and uptime. Think Google, Meta, or Amazon, operating at hyperscale allows businesses to meet user demand seamlessly.

4. Edge Computing: Decentralised Performance

Imagine self-driving cars needing real-time decision-making or IoT devices in factories needing instant feedback. Processing all this data centrally creates latency. Enter edge computing, a strategy that moves data processing capabilities nearer to where the data is actually generated. Edge data centres reduce data travel time, improve application responsiveness, and lower bandwidth costs. IDC projects that by 2025, around 75% of all data will be generated and processed at the edge, closer to where it’s created.

Q1. What is the difference between a traditional and a hyperscale data centre?
A traditional data centre supports limited workloads and scalability. Hyperscale data centres, however, are built for rapid, massive scaling, hosting thousands of servers with superior performance.

Q2. Why is a hybrid cloud better than a single cloud model?
Hybrid cloud offers flexibility, sensitive data stays secure in a private cloud, while public cloud handles scalable workloads, giving the best of both worlds.

Q3. How does edge computing benefit businesses?
Edge computing handles data closer to its origin, minimising latency and enabling instant insights, perfect for IoT, AI, and intelligent applications.
